#Memberlist_Main .Memberlist_Top {
  position: relative;
  overflow: hidden;
  height: 120px;
  background: linear-gradient(to bottom, var(--designlink), var(--designlinksec));
}

#Memberlist_Main .Memberlist_Info{
  background: var(--designlinkthird);
  color: var(--designtextheader);
  padding: 6px 20px;
  letter-spacing: 1.5px;
  font-style: italic;
  font-family: Inter;
  font-weight: 600;
  text-transform: uppercase;
  font-size: 8px;
  height: 8px;
  text-align: center;
  line-height: 1;
}

#Memberlist_Main .Memberlist_Mem_Desc{
  border: 30px solid transparent;
  text-align: justify;
  font-family: Work Sans;
  font-weight: 400;
  font-size: 11px;
  letter-spacing: 0.5px;
  line-height: 156%;
  position: relative;
  height: 80px;
  overflow: hidden;
}

#Memberlist_Main .Memberlist_Mem_Desc > div{
  overflow: auto;
  scrollbar-width: thin;
  scrollbar-color: var(--designlinksec) var(--designsecback);
  height: 85px;
  margin: -4px 0;
  padding-right: 6px;
}

#Memberlist_Main .Memberlist_Top_Name spaner de,
#Memberlist_Main .Memberlist_Info de{color: var(--designsecback);}
#Memberlist_Main .Memberlist_Top_Name spaner {
  background: var(--designlinkthird);
  color: var(--designtextheader);
  clip-path: polygon(0 0, 100% 0%, 90% 100%, 0% 100%);
  padding: 6px 20px 6px 33px;
  letter-spacing: 1.5px;
  font-style: italic;
  font-family: Inter;
  font-weight: 600;
  text-transform: uppercase;
  font-size: 8px;
  line-height: 1;
  height: 8px;
  margin-top: 1px;
  text-align: right;
  width: fit-content;
  position: absolute;
  left: -25px;
  top: 60px;
}

#Memberlist_Main .Memberlist_Top_Name{
  position: absolute;
  top: 17px;
  left: 115px;
  font-family: Montserrat;
  font-weight: 800;
  text-transform: uppercase;
  font-size: 20px;
  text-align: left;
  letter-spacing: 1.5px;
	width: 250px;
}

#Memberlist_Main .Memberlist_Top_Name span{
  display: block;
  font-size: 35px;
  margin-top: -5px;
  font-weight: 200;
  color: var(--designfifthback);
  text-shadow: 2px 1px 1px var(--designeightback);
  margin-left: 6px;
  line-height: 100%;
}

#Memberlist_Main .Memberlist_Top_Name a{color: var(--designtextcolor);}

#Memberlist_Main .Memberlist_Top_BGIcon {
  color: var(--designfifthback);
  pointer-events: none;
  font-size: 100px;
  position: absolute;
  bottom: -25px;
  right: -15px;
  transform: scaleX(-1) rotate(24deg);
  opacity: 0.1;
}

#Memberlist_Main .Memberlist_Top_Icon{margin: 17.5px 30px;width: min-content;position: relative;z-index: 1;}

#Memberlist_Main .Memberlist_Top_Icon font {
  display: block;
  width: 63px;
  height: 63px;
  background-color: var(--designthirdback);
  border: 1px solid var(--designsixback);
  overflow: hidden;
  border-radius: 50%;
  padding: 10px;
}

#Memberlist_Main .Memberlist_Top_Icon span {
  display: block;
  width: 100%;
  height: 100%;
  overflow: hidden;
  clip-path: circle(50% at 50% 50%);
  position: relative;
}

#Memberlist_Main .Memberlist_Top_Icon img {width: 100%;}
#Memberlist_Main .Memberlist_Box{width: 383px;background-color: var(--designthirdback);}

#Memberlist_Main .Memberlist_Wrapper{
  padding: 10px;
  background-color: var(--designsecback);
  margin: 15px 0px;
}

#Memberlist_Main .Memberlist_Flex{
  padding: 13px;
  border: 2px solid var(--designthirdback);
  display: flex;
  flex-wrap: wrap;
  row-gap: 10px;
  column-gap: 10px;
}

#Memberlist_Main .Memberlist_Name{
  background-color: var(--designlinkthird);
  color: var(--designsecback);
  padding: 10px 30px;
  text-transform: uppercase;
  font-family: Montserrat;
  font-size: 40px;
  font-weight: 800;
  letter-spacing: 2px;
  position: relative;
}

#Memberlist_Main .Memberlist_Sub a{color: var(--designsecback);}
#Memberlist_Main .Memberlist_Sub{
  background: var(--designlink);
  color: var(--designsecback);
  clip-path: polygon(0% 0, 100% 0%, 98% 100%, 0% 100%);
  letter-spacing: 1.5px;
  font-style: italic;
  font-family: Inter;
  font-weight: bold;
  text-transform: uppercase;
  font-size: 8px;
  text-align: left;
  padding: 3px 20px 3px 30px;
  width: fit-content;
  margin: -4px 0px 7px -30px;
}